Current State of the Chip Industry

The chip industry is currently experiencing a period of unprecedented growth, driven by the surging demand for computing power and the proliferation of connected devices. According to Gartner, the global semiconductor revenue is projected to reach $661.5 billion in 2023, a 5.3% increase from 2022.

Key Trends

Several key trends are shaping the future of the chip industry, including:

  • Miniaturization: Chips are becoming increasingly smaller and more powerful, allowing for the development of smaller and more efficient devices.
  • Increased Connectivity: Chips are becoming more connected to the internet and other devices, enabling the growth of the Internet of Things (IoT) and smart cities.
  • Artificial Intelligence: Chips are becoming more specialized for AI applications, enabling the development of more advanced AI algorithms and machine learning models.

Innovation and Disruption in the Chip Industry

The chip industry is witnessing a constant stream of innovation and disruption. Here are some of the most notable developments:

  • Quantum Computing: Quantum computers have the potential to revolutionize a wide range of industries, from drug discovery to materials science.
  • Edge Computing: Edge computing brings computation and storage closer to where data is generated, reducing latency and improving performance for real-time applications.
  • Neuromorphic Chips: Neuromorphic chips are designed to mimic the human brain, enabling more efficient and powerful AI systems.

Frequently Asked Questions (FAQs)

Q: What is the difference between CPUs and GPUs?

A: CPUs are general-purpose chips designed to handle a wide range of tasks, while GPUs are specialized for parallel computing and graphics processing.
